Wood Versus Composite Options
Choosing the ideal deck material is crucial for securing aesthetic appeal and durability in every outdoor endeavor. Residents see the full story generally face a choice between modern composite materials and traditional wood. Timber, commonly chosen for its warmth and natural beauty, provides a classic look that many regard as desirable. That said, it may require additional upkeep, including sealing and staining. On the other hand, composite decking materials provide a wide selection of colors and finishes while typically remaining better protected against insect damage, fading, and splintering. This renders composite decking a compelling choice for those seeking low maintenance. At the end of the day, the decision copyrights on personal preference, budget considerations, and the desired look for the outdoor living space, rendering it necessary to consider the benefits and drawbacks of both materials.

How to Maintain Your New Deck for Long-Lasting Results
Maintaining a new deck is essential for protecting its durability and aesthetic appeal over time. Routine cleaning serves as a foundational step; using a gentle soap and water solution can effectively eliminate dirt and stains. It's advisable to perform this maintenance at least twice annually, particularly in advance of and after the busiest periods of use.
Another critical step involves sealing the deck. The application of a high-quality sealant defends the wood against moisture and UV damage, increasing its overall lifespan. This process should be repeated every one to three years, depending on the deck's exposure to the elements.
Checking the deck for indicators of deterioration, such as loose boards or rusted nails, is equally essential. Early fixes can stop further structural issues. Furthermore, keeping plants and furniture off the deck's surface can prevent surface damage and encourage ventilation, limiting fungal buildup. Applying these guidelines will ensure a stunning and long-lasting deck area.

How Long Does It Take to Build a Deck?
Constructing a deck usually spans one to three weeks, depending on factors such as size, materials, and weather conditions. Careful planning and professional labor can significantly impact the general timeframe for finishing the project.
What Permits Do You Need for Deck Construction?
Constructing a deck typically requires approvals such as building, zoning, and possibly environmental permits, according to regional guidelines. Property owners should review local regulations to guarantee compliance and avoid potential fines or construction delays.
Can I Build a Deck on Uneven Ground?
Indeed, a deck is able to be built on uneven ground. Nevertheless, proper planning and leveling techniques are essential to maintain structural integrity and safety. Working with an expert could help establish the best approach for specific terrain challenges.
What Is the Average Cost of Deck Installation?
The average cost of deck installation usually sits between $15 to $35 per square foot. Variables that impact this price include building materials, structural complexity, and area labor expenses, which can greatly affect the final expenditure.
Are There Eco-Friendly Deck Material Options Available?
There are many sustainable deck material alternatives to consider, including reclaimed wood, bamboo, and composite materials crafted from recycled plastics. These options not only minimize environmental impact but also provide durability and visual appeal for outdoor areas.
